El Concurso de Televisión para Jóvenes Cantantes*** tiene 10 concursantes participando y 12 jueces al calcular la puntuación promedio de cada concursante.
Análisis de ideas: dado que hay 12 jueces, cada jugador tendrá 12 puntajes. Podemos usar una estructura de bucle para resolver la entrada de estos 12 puntajes y usar variables acumulativas para encontrar el valor de estos 12 números. y. La clave de esta pregunta es encontrar los valores máximo y mínimo de estos 12 puntajes de entrada para restarlos del puntaje total, ya que el puntaje mínimo de cada jugador es 0 puntos y el puntaje máximo es 10 puntos. , también podríamos establecer que el número máximo sea 0 y el número mínimo sea 10. Luego, cada vez que se ingresa una puntuación, se realiza una comparación. Si el número ingresado es mayor que 0, lo usamos para reemplazar el número máximo. Si el número ingresado es menor que 10, lo usamos para reemplazar el número mínimo y la comparación continúa en secuencia, puede encontrar los números máximo y mínimo entre los 12 números. Al final del ciclo, reste el máximo y. números mínimos del total, y luego dividir por 10 para obtener la puntuación promedio del jugador.
Solución: Los pasos del programa son los siguientes:
s=0
k=1
max=0
min=10
Hacer
ENTRADA x
s=s+x
SI max<=x ENTONCES
max=x
FIN SI
SI min>=x ENTONCES
min=x
END IF
BUCLE HASTA k>12
a=s-max-min
s=s/10
IMPRIMIR un
FIN